Matches (28)
The Ashes (1)
Vijay Hazare Trophy (19)
Sri Lanka Women tour of India (1)
Super Smash (1)
BBL (2)
BPL (2)
ILT20 (1)
SA20 (1)
Ravikant Shukla prepares to defend the ball, Saurashtra v Uttar Pradesh, 2nd semi-final, Ranji Trophy Super League, Vadodara, 1st day, January 5, 2008

Ravikant Shukla prepares to defend the ball

Ravikant Shukla is clean bowled, India v Pakistan, Under-19 World Cup final, Colombo, February 19, 2006
Ravikant Shukla is clean bowled••Getty Images
One hand on the trophy - Pakistan and India will fight for glory in the Under-19 World Cup final on Sunday, Under-19 World Cup, Colombo, February 18, 2006
One hand on the trophy - Pakistan and India will fight for glory in the Under-19 World Cup final on Sunday••International Cricket Council
Ravikant Shukla and Sarfraz Ahmed at the toss of the Under-19 World Cup final, India v Pakistan, Under-19 World Cup final, Colombo, February 19, 2006
Ravikant Shukla and Sarfraz Ahmed at the toss of the Under-19 World Cup final••International Cricket Council
Ravikant Shukla, Uttar Pradesh Under-16s, Portrait
Ravikant Shukla, Portrait••ESPNcricinfo Ltd